Colonial Van & Storage, Inc. v. Superior Court (Dominguez)

Ruling by

Elwood G. Lui

Lower Court

Fresno County Superior Court

Lower Court Judge

Kristi Culver Kapetan
Employers do not have a duty to ensure that coworkers and business associates are safe from a third party's criminal conduct when they are visiting the private residence of an employee who works from home.
